LineFlip — LineFlip.net

Now live on iOS

LineFlip — a reservation marketplace built around automated operations

Designed, built and launched end to end under Jandas Corporation — the iOS app now live on the App Store, alongside the publishing tools, payment gateway and cloud infrastructure. The engagement-operations platform was architected from day one so AI-assisted workflows can handle the repetitive work as volume grows: listings publish, demand is analyzed, guests are engaged and followed up, and payments reconcile — with people approving the decisions that matter. It is the same agent-and-automation architecture we build for clients, running on a live product.

Omnicircuit

Connected hardware / Fleet

End-to-end GPS vehicle tracking and camera platform

Built an entire fleet-tracking product from zero: device firmware, Linux TCP/UDP servers, web dashboard, PostGIS geocoding backend and a covert vehicle camera module — hardware, cloud and interface in one loop.
